Why Voice?

Among all biometric signals, voice is the most emotionally expressive and information-rich. It is involuntary, continuous, and deeply personal—revealing not just what someone says, but how they feel when they say it. Tiny fluctuations in tone, pitch, pacing, volume, breath, and resonance encode stress, joy, grief, doubt, and countless other inner states—often long before the speaker is consciously aware of them.

In terms of signal-to-emotion ratio, voice outperforms facial expressions, text, and even physiological sensors, making it the singularly most valuable input for modeling emotional state in real-time. This is why VEIL places voice at the center of its architecture—transforming spoken experience into emotionally intelligent insight while keeping the user’s identity veiled and secure.

Model Strategy: A Time-Series Trifecta Ensemble

To support diverse timescales and neurocognitive interpretations of emotion, DREAM employs three complementary models to process vector embeddings from real-time voice streams:

Temporal Convolutional Networks (TCN)

  • Strengths: Sequential pattern recognition, especially useful for detecting rhythm shifts or habitual speech markers.

  • Use case: Identify emotional regression or spiraling behavior over multi-day windows.

Spiking Neural Networks (SNN)

  • Strengths: Neurobiologically inspired; excellent for detecting event-based thresholds and sudden spikes in stress or emotion.

  • Use case: Early warning signs of crisis escalation or panic events.

Temporal Fusion Transformers (TFT)

  • Strengths: Combines time-series precision with contextual attention, allowing DREAM to factor in external signals (e.g., day of week, conversation topic, time since last interaction).

  • Use case: Building an emotionally intelligent support plan that adjusts dynamically to context shifts.

Privacy & Local Processing

To protect user sovereignty:

  • All initial voice embeddings are computed on-device using lightweight Transformer or XGBoost variants.

  • Only encrypted vectors (not raw audio) are transmitted.

  • Models are containerized within the user's secure session (Dockerized in encrypted vaults), complying with DREAM's zero raw data policy.
